If you are using a DOS-based system, you can directly start ODS.
You must modify the PATH command in the AUTOEXEC.BAT file
by adding this entry to t he path:
;C:\IMC
If you want ODS to start automatically when you turn on the
computer, add this entry to the last line of the AUTOEXEC.BAT file:
IMC
Refer to the computer’s DOS manual f or further instructions.
If for any reason you need to remove the ODS software from t he
computer’s hard disk, use the following procedure:
Important: This procedure assumes that the floppy-disk drive is
drive A and the hard -disk drive is drive C. If the drive
designations on your computer are different, substitute
the appropriate designations.
Important: Before you remove the ODS software from the hard
disk, back up any projects you need to save, then delete
all of the projects.
1. Insert ODS disk 1 in floppy-disk drive A.
2. If you are at the
C: prompt, t ype:
a:
and press [ENTER].
3. At the prompt, type:
a:remove
and press [ENTER].
